The Role of Natural Light

Natural Light Coworking space

One influential factor within any workspace is natural light—it influences moods, activity levels, and even productivity. Natural light can reduce eye strain, improve sleep conditions, and increase general well-being.

Large, wall-to-ceiling windows with skylights and sharply positioned glass partitions are all means of allowing as much natural light into the coworking space design as possible. Light-colored paint or reflective surfaces may further emphasize the available light. Another approach would be to arrange workstations closer to windows so that more members can benefit from it as an uplifting design feature.

Adjustable Workstations

Flexibility is essential in the coworking space design because it accommodates professionals with different work styles. Options for workstations—from standing desks to lounger areas, private booths, and shared tables—will give people the ability to gravitate toward a preference or task. Flexible workstations not only bring comfort but also stimulate movement and cut down on the drabness associated with being glued to one position. Indeed, a coworking space can ensure a dynamic and adaptive work environment with a combination of seating arrangements and adjustable furniture.

Furniture with Ergonomic Design

Office Workstations design

Ergonomic furniture is essential for every workspace to help workers stay healthy and productive. Bad ergonomics create discomfort, fatigue, and serious long-term health issues that negatively impact work performance. The necessity is to invest seriously in good ergonomic chairs, adjustable desks, appendages, or complementariness that would go along with them, such as a footrest or a monitor stand. Look for chairs that are designed to provide support in the lumbar area, have adjustable armrests, and have seat height adjustment.

Also, desks that are designed so that users have the alternative of either standing or sitting can foster better posture, thereby reducing the risk of musculoskeletal problems.

Collaborative Areas

Colorful Co-Working Space with Modern Design

The design should stress collaboration since it is one of the basic principles for which the creative coworking space design was created. This is confirmed through open spaces with shared tables and comfortable chairs, whiteboards, and the like that facilitate spontaneous discussion and idea-sharing. These must balance, however, against quiet zones where individuals may specifically work without distraction. Using flexible partitions, acoustic panels, and dedicated meeting rooms ensures the creation of a harmonious mixture of spaces for collaboration and quiet pursuits. This touches on members freedom of choice about working conditions within the spaces for the tasks at hand.

Biophilic Design

eco-friendly co working space design

Biophilic design, which brings aspects of nature into the built environment, can alleviate mental stress and impact mental well-being positively. This can be achieved by adding plants, natural materials, and water features to create a sensation of calm and refreshment. Exciting new ways of bringing some of the outdoors in include green walls, indoor gardens, and carefully sited potted plants.

This would be achievable by replacing furniture and ornaments with materials like wood, stone, and bamboo. It could also integrate elements of biophilic design to create a more attractive and healthier space for coworking members.

Wellness Amenities

office yoga classes

By maintaining an atmosphere of wellness in a coworking space, it should ideally spawn a happier, healthier, and more productive membership base.

Wellness facilities, such as meditation areas, exercise corners, and sleeping pods, provide great breaks to recharge the weary. Offer yoga classes or wellness workshops, or go ahead and take more incentives, like access to certified in-house fitness trainers. Complement these with healthy food and beverages, ergonomic workstations, and other health-oriented amenities that help engender better well-being among constituents. Coworking spaces would be able to focus more on creating a sense of community and promoting physical and mental health.
